Output 66b7a905d98711b1c26250e45f002571dc0d05afbec31e3623adfe304370fa44:12

value
3900512
script pubkey
OP_0 OP_PUSHBYTES_32 c40971ce7e570bed8b7d5dc80a7c8ec17b94c72ac79976b1db09aa87c47d68fe
address
bc1qcsyhrnn72u97mzmathyq5lywc9aef3e2c7vhdvwmpx4g03radrlqjdx7n5
transaction
66b7a905d98711b1c26250e45f002571dc0d05afbec31e3623adfe304370fa44
spent
true